Stafford Virginia Realtor

from:

Sometimes relocating to a new town can be almost impossible to deal with. There is so much research and learning to do that it is sometimes easier to just stay in the town that you already live in. But, if giving up is not an option, or the desire is there to move to a new town, then the research can pay off. One of the best things to do is to take a look at the local realtors in the town.

Moving to a town like Stafford, Virginia can be as stressful as moving to any other town. Although it is a smaller town and nothing like moving to New York City or San Diego, it can still be a hard thing to deal with. There are many Stafford Virginia realtors in the area that can help with relocating to a new town. Virginia is a very popular place for people to be moving to right now and many people like the area because it is small and the prices are good.

As with relocating to any city, the research must be done on the town. While the research is being done on the town, some research should be done into finding the right realtor. There are many hometown realtor companies in towns like these that are extremely helpful because they have lived in the area their whole lives. Stafford Virginia realtors know the land and the prices extremely well and can help anybody purchase the right home.

Looking online will not always be the best way to find a realtor in a place like that. Many Stafford Virginia realtors have very simple web pages that do not have home listings or average prices of their homes. They may have an e-mail that you should use to contact and get more information from. Stafford Virginia realtors thrive on personal communication and can help much more than putting up a website that has a bunch of homes for sale for people to look at.

Being personal helps Stafford Virginia realtors do their job much better because they can pinpoint what type of house the family needs and what price range they can purchase it for. This helps many families out because they are not pressured into buying something they do not want.

Finding the right Stafford Virginia realtors is not hard, but it does take a little bit of time. It is important to talk to a couple of them and not just pick the first one that you talk to. Many people do this and find out that they should have went with someone else down the road and ended up wasting a lot of time they didn’t have.
